簡介:bcrypt是一種跨平臺(tái)的文件加密工具。 Bcrypt就是一款加密工具,可以比較方便地實(shí)現(xiàn)數(shù)據(jù)的加密工作。你也可以簡單理解為它內(nèi)部自己實(shí)現(xiàn)了隨機(jī)加鹽處理 例如,我們使用...

簡介:bcrypt是一種跨平臺(tái)的文件加密工具。 Bcrypt就是一款加密工具,可以比較方便地實(shí)現(xiàn)數(shù)據(jù)的加密工作。你也可以簡單理解為它內(nèi)部自己實(shí)現(xiàn)了隨機(jī)加鹽處理 例如,我們使用...
1、引言 從Spring 3開始引入了Spring表達(dá)式語言,它能夠以一種強(qiáng)大而簡潔的方式將值裝配到Bean屬性和構(gòu)造器參數(shù)中,在這個(gè)過程中所使用的表達(dá)式會(huì)在運(yùn)行時(shí)計(jì)算得到值...
表達(dá)式示例execution(* com.sample.service.impl...(..))詳述: execution(),表達(dá)式的主體第一個(gè)“”符號(hào),表示返回值類型任意...
最近看到aop,就做一點(diǎn)小小的總結(jié)。 一、AOP的基本概念: 1、什么是aop: AOP(Aspect Oriented Programming)稱為面向切面編程,在程序開發(fā)...
一、對AOP的初印象 首先先給出一段比較專業(yè)的術(shù)語(來自百度): 然后我們舉一個(gè)比較容易理解的例子(來自:Spring 之 AOP): 要理解切面編程,就需要先理解什么是切面...
前言 嗯,我應(yīng)該是有一段實(shí)現(xiàn)沒有寫過博客了,在寫完了細(xì)說Spring——AOP詳解(AOP概覽)之后,我發(fā)現(xiàn)我不知道該怎么寫AOP這一部分,所以就把寫博客這件事給放下了,但是...
1. 啟動(dòng)配置 要加"m"說明是MB,否則就是KB了-Xms:初始值-Xmx:最大值-Xmn:最小值java -Xms10m -Xmx80m -jar mod.jar &時(shí)區(qū)...
四種mysql存儲(chǔ)引擎 前言 數(shù)據(jù)庫存儲(chǔ)引擎是數(shù)據(jù)庫底層軟件組織,數(shù)據(jù)庫管理系統(tǒng)(DBMS)使用數(shù)據(jù)引擎進(jìn)行創(chuàng)建、查詢、更新和刪除數(shù)據(jù)。不同的存儲(chǔ)引擎提供不同的存儲(chǔ)機(jī)制、索引...
以前的Java項(xiàng)目中,充斥著太多不友好的代碼:POJO的getter/setter/toString;異常處理;I/O流的關(guān)閉操作等等,這些樣板代碼既沒有技術(shù)含量,又影響著代...
HTTP簡介 HTTP協(xié)議是Hyper Text Transfer Protocol(超文本傳輸協(xié)議)的縮寫,是用于從萬維網(wǎng)(WWW:World Wide Web )服務(wù)器傳...
簡介 JUnit 是一個(gè) Java 編程語言的單元測試框架。JUnit 在測試驅(qū)動(dòng)的開發(fā)方面有很重要的發(fā)展,是起源于 JUnit 的一個(gè)統(tǒng)稱為 xUnit 的單元測試框架之一...